Banda Yeh Bindaas Hai is a Bollywood film directed by Ravi Chopra, featuring a star-studded cast including Salman Khan, Lara Dutta, Govinda, Tabu, and Boman Irani. Initially slated for release on June 25, 2010, the film faced significant legal challenges due to allegations of plagiarism from the 1992 comedy "My Cousin Vinny." The movie was initially scheduled for release on June 25, 2010. However, it encountered significant legal hurdles that delayed its release.
In 2009, 20th Century Fox served a legal notice to Ravi Chopra and BR Films, alleging that Banda Yeh Bindaas Hai was a blatant copy of the 1992 Hollywood comedy My Cousin Vinny. According to Fox, the film was not just "loosely based" on the original but was a "substantial reproduction" (Times of India).
Fox sought damages amounting to $1.4 million, marking the first instance where a Bollywood filmmaker was taken to court by a Hollywood studio over copyright infringement. The Bombay High Court ordered a delay in the film's release until June 2009 (Express India).
This case was pivotal in the Indian film industry, highlighting the need for Bollywood filmmakers to either create original content or legally acquire rights for adaptations. The Kolkata Telegraph noted that the outcome of this case would determine whether Indian filmmakers could continue to draw "inspiration" from Hollywood without facing legal repercussions (The Telegraph).
Despite the legal challenges, Banda Yeh Bindaas Hai was eventually slated for release on June 25, 2010. However, the film's release was overshadowed by the legal controversies, and it did not perform well at the box office.
Banda Yeh Bindaas Hai serves as a significant case study in the realm of intellectual property rights within the film industry. The legal battle between 20th Century Fox and BR Films underscored the importance of respecting copyright laws and acquiring proper permissions for adaptations. While the film itself may not have left a lasting impact, its legal ramifications continue to influence Bollywood practices today.
